Strawberry Matcha Basque Cheesecake

Strawberry Matcha Basque Cheesecake


  • Author: Chef Bella
  • Total Time: 5 hours 10 minutes (including chilling)
  • Yield: 8 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Strawberry Matcha Basque Cheesecake is a vibrant and creamy dessert that combines the burnt top of traditional Basque cheesecake with the earthy richness of matcha and the fruity sweetness of fresh strawberries. This fusion delivers a visually stunning and flavor-packed treat.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ups (500g) c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up (200g) granulated s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up (240ml) heavy cream
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on matcha powder
  • 1 cup (250g) fresh strawberries, puréed
  • 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
  • A pinch of sal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a 9-inch springform pan with parchment paper, allowing some overhang.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and granulated sugar using an electric mixer on medium speed until smooth and creamy.
  3.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ing on low speed until just incorporated.
  4. Gradually pour in the heavy cream and vanilla extract, continuing to mix until fully blended. Do not overmix.
  5. In a separate bowl, mix the matcha powder with a tablespoon of warm water to form a paste. Add this to the cheesecake mixture and mix until fully incorporated.
  6. Gently fold in the strawberry purée using a spatula to create a marbled effect.
  7.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th out the top.
  8. Bake for 45-50 minutes or until the top is golden-brown and the center is slightly jiggly but set.
  9. Allow the cheesecake to cool to room temperature, then ref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ight before serving.

Notes

  • Do not overmix the batter to avoid cracking during baking.
  • Use high-quality matcha for better color and flavor.
  • Allow the cheesecake to fully chill before slicing for the cleanest cuts.
